A Fresh Start With Fresh Strength and Fresh Abundance

Fresh Start

Do you need new life for the new year? Fresh strength? A new start? A blessed path?

God is making all things new! Even our hard pathways will overflow with abundance.

  • “If anyone is in Christ, he is a new creation. The old has passed away; behold, the new has come.” (2 Corinthians 5:17, ESV)
  • “I am making everything new!” (Revelation 21:5, NIV)

Making Everything New

If your life has been like mine, this past year has been hard and discouraging. I didn’t think circumstances could get any worse than they have been for the past three years. (I spent years unable to eat food due to untreatable Long Covid asthma. A feeding tube is not an option either, as enteral nutrition would also trigger an asthma attack.)

Life has been unimaginably rough and disappointing the past few years. But the holiday season presents unavoidable landmarks in time on which to reflect and compare.  It’s nearly impossible to not remember last year… and notice that as sick as I was last year, this year is worse.

The Thanksgiving and Christmas holiday season last year was a low point. I couldn’t figure out how I was going to obtain enough nutrition to stay alive. … But this year, I’m even more sick and disabled. It’s tempting to lose hope.

However, the God who created the world is currently making everything new!

You and I have a reason to hope! To believe God to do what He promised! To expect Him to guide us, provide for us, and make even our hard pathways overflow with abundance.

Watch for the New Thing

We can’t afford to dwell on what happened this past year. If we do, we’ll miss what God is doing in the days to come!

We must stand alert, watching, and ready for the new thing God is doing in our lives!

“Do not cling to events of the past or dwell on what happened long ago. Watch for the new thing I am going to do. It is happening already—you can see it now! I will make a road through the wilderness and give you streams of water there.” (Isaiah 43:18-19, GNT)

God is leading us and forging a path for us in the new year. 

“He leads me beside still waters. He restores my soul. He leads me in paths of righteousness for his name’s sake.” (Psalm 23:2-3, ESV)

I desperately need a restored soul. Don’t you? The past four years have left me mentally, physically, and spiritually drained to the core. But God promised us a restored and refreshed soul!

The word for “restore” in the original language means to “turn back,” to “return to the starting point,” or to do something “again.”

I ache for the person I used to be spiritually. For the spiritual hunger I used to have. Life has taken me through an extended spiritual drought that has left me parched to the bone. I can’t seem to go backward and become the person I used to be no matter how badly I long for it, or how hard I strive for it … or how deeply I mourn for the person I used to be.

But there is good news for you and me! God promised us a restored soul!

Abundance

Jesus is guiding us every moment of our lives. We are never outside of His love and power, no matter how pitch black our dark night of the soul might be.

He will lead us every minute of the coming year. And what’s more? He will leave abundance in His wake—even in the hard places:

“You crown the year with a bountiful harvest; even the hard pathways overflow with abundance.” (Psalm 65:11, NLT)

New Year Blessings

So let’s embrace the new year with confident expectation in God! Not with doom and gloom . . . or comparisons to what God has allowed to happen in our past . . or with negativity and doubt.

He is doing a new thing in our lives!
